  • Could you explain exactly what is this, please?

    I mean, on the video, I see F-zero 2's cars racing on classic F-Zero tracks, with cool remixed music and absolutely crazy japanese narrator.

    And on the actual game... I see nothing of that >_>

    Again... what is this?

  • From how I understand, this is a VHS recording of the game being played on it's actual "Broadcast date" which St. Giga offered it, running on the actual hardware.

    Emulators (with a few exceptions) don't emulate the Satellaview very well, and no one has ever recorded a clean copy of that audio data to my knowledge. Therefore, this video is likely the closest one could get to the "actual expereince".
